Market Volatility
Cryptocurrencies have recently experienced dramatic fluctuations. Bitcoin and Ethereum saw significant gains of 76% and 72%, respectively, but both faced subsequent declines of 21% and an even steeper drop for Ethereum, currently down 52% from their mid-December peaks. Dogecoin, known for its volatility, surged 361% only to drop 63% since December. This unpredictability raises concerns for potential investors.

Polkadot Performance
Polkadot, despite aspirations for Web3 dominance, has underperformed against the S&P 500 over the past five years. Its price has recently hovered around $4.40, showing a modest 5% gain in the last six months, indicating a lack of upward momentum compared to broader market expectations.

Technical Developments
Polkadot aims to pivot toward providing heavy-duty computing capabilities through its new JAM protocol. While projects like Ethereum and Solana enhance their smart contract functionalities, Polkadot’s approach could potentially set it apart in the future if successful. However, it currently lacks performance to warrant significant investor confidence.
